Understanding What Adderall Is

Adderall is a central nervous system stimulant that contains a combination of amphetamine salts. It is primarily prescribed to treat ADHD, a neurodevelopmental disorder characterized by inattentiveness, impulsivity, and hyperactivity. Adderall works by increasing the levels of neurotransmitters such as dopamine and norepinephrine in the brain, improving focus and reducing symptoms of ADHD.

While highly effective for those with diagnosed conditions, Adderall also comes with risks, including side effects like insomnia, increased heart rate, and the potential for dependency if misused. This is why obtaining it legally is crucial to your health and safety.

Step 2: Consult a Healthcare Professional

The first step in legally obtaining an Adderall prescription is scheduling a consultation with a healthcare provider. This can be your primary care physician, a psychiatrist, or a specialist in ADHD or sleep disorders.

What to Expect During the Consultation:

  1. Discussion of Symptoms:

    Be prepared to discuss your symptoms in detail. For ADHD, this may include difficulty concentrating, trouble organizing tasks, forgetfulness, or feeling overwhelmed. For narcolepsy, describe issues like extreme fatigue, sleep paralysis, or unexpected sleep episodes.

  1. Medical History:

    Your doctor will ask about your medical history, including any pre-existing conditions, medications you are currently taking, and family history of ADHD or related disorders.

  1. Diagnostic Tools:

    For ADHD, your doctor may use standardized questionnaires, rating scales, or interviews to assess your symptoms. In some cases, neuropsychological testing may be recommended for a more comprehensive evaluation.

    For narcolepsy, a sleep study or polysomnography may be necessary.

The goal of the consultation is to determine whether Adderall is an appropriate treatment option for your condition. If your doctor identifies that you meet the criteria for ADHD or narcolepsy, they may consider prescribing Adderall as part of your treatment plan.

Step 5: Consider Alternatives if Necessary

Adderall is not the only medication available for ADHD or narcolepsy. If you experience side effects or if your doctor determines that Adderall is not suitable for you, they may recommend other options, such as:

    Other Stimulants:

    Medications like Ritalin (methylphenidate) or Vyvanse (lisdexamfetamine) may be effective alternatives.

    Non-Stimulant Medications:

    Non-stimulant options like Strattera (atomoxetine) or certain antidepressants can also help manage ADHD symptoms.

    Therapies:

    Behavioral therapy, counseling, and lifestyle changes may complement or replace medication for some individuals.

Step 6: Stay Informed About Legal and Safe Practices

The misuse of Adderall is a growing concern, particularly among students and professionals seeking to enhance focus or productivity. To ensure you are obtaining and using Adderall legally and safely, keep the following points in mind:

  1. Avoid Online Pharmacies Without a Prescription:

    Be cautious of websites that claim to sell Adderall without a prescription. These sites often operate illegally and may sell counterfeit or unsafe medications.

  1. Understand Local Laws:

    Adderall is a controlled substance classified as a Schedule II drug in the United States. This means it is subject to strict regulations, and obtaining it without a prescription is illegal.

  1. Regular Check-Ins with Your Doctor:

    Most doctors require regular follow-up appointments to monitor your progress and ensure that the medication is working effectively. Be sure to attend these appointments and communicate any changes in your symptoms or health.
